Перейти к содержанию

Помогите выставить фьюз в picpgm для pic 18f25k50


seregapplk

Рекомендуемые сообщения

Всем спасибо огромное! Happy end))) Действительно в диспетчере определился чип стар, драйвер поставил, софтину в прогере обновил, атмегу по isp восьмую коннектнул, и полная пятая точка радости :D

Ссылка на комментарий
Поделиться на другие сайты

  • 3 недели спустя...

Реклама: ООО ТД Промэлектроника, ИНН: 6659197470, Тел: 8 (800) 1000-321

Также прошил этот контролер только программатор собирал JDM ошибок нет верификацию прошла.

Вот только при подключении не поднимается питание на программаторе когда поставил этот пик. 

Если подать принудительно то программатор определяется корректно в системе но к самой оболочке и проверочной программе не подключается может быть что не так с битами настройки.

Ссылка на комментарий
Поделиться на другие сайты

20% скидка на весь каталог электронных компонентов в ТМ Электроникс!

Акция "Лето ближе - цены ниже", успей сделать выгодные покупки!

Плюс весь апрель действует скидка 10% по промокоду APREL24 + 15% кэшбэк и бесплатная доставка!

Перейти на страницу акции

Реклама: ООО ТМ ЭЛЕКТРОНИКС, ИНН: 7806548420, info@tmelectronics.ru, +7(812)4094849

28.12.2020 в 01:09, Сергей Орищенко сказал:

///////////

У меня из подводных камней был полурабочий мосфет по цепи питания, тоже принудительно открывал пинцетом коротил(заменил), и была сопля по пайке, банальное КЗ, повезло ничего не спалил. А по поводу настроечных битов, вроде всё здесь разжевали.. проверьте для начало качество пайки, бывает банальная невнимательность, у меня было так)) 

Ссылка на комментарий
Поделиться на другие сайты

Особенности хранения литиевых аккумуляторов и батареек

Потеря емкости аккумулятора напрямую зависит от условий хранения и эксплуатации. При неправильном хранении даже самый лучший литиевый источник тока с превосходными характеристиками может не оправдать ожиданий. Технология, основанная на рекомендациях таких известных производителей литиевых источников тока, как компании FANSO и EVE Energy, поможет организовать правильный процесс хранения батареек и аккумуляторов. Подробнее>>

Реклама: АО КОМПЭЛ, ИНН: 7713005406, ОГРН: 1027700032161

Включение нашел . Но при проверке программатора проблема с входом Х1 вывод пика MCLR/RE3 похоже он не управляется.

Я наверное неправильно выставил бит  а именно MCLRE.Какой из двух нужен?

 

Ссылка на комментарий
Поделиться на другие сайты

Секреты депассивации литиевых батареек FANSO EVE Energy

Самыми лучшими параметрами по энергоемкости, сроку хранения, температурному диапазону и номинальному напряжению обладают батарейки литий-тионилхлоридной электрохимической системы. Но при длительном хранении происходит процесс пассивации. Разберем в чем плюсы и минусы, как можно ее избежать или уменьшить последствия и как проводить депассивацию батареек на примере продукции и рекомендаций компании FANSO EVE Energy. Подробнее>>

Реклама: АО КОМПЭЛ, ИНН: 7713005406, ОГРН: 1027700032161

Нет я на последней вкладке выставлял у меня нет битов в 16-тиричном виде 

Нашел вот такое если по ней судить то нужно    MCLR pin is alternate   function ставить завтра попробую.

MCLRE = OFF0x3FDFMCLR pin is alternate function.

MCLRE = ON0x3FFFMCLR pin is MCLR function with internal weak pullup.

Ссылка на комментарий
Поделиться на другие сайты

А можно взять этот код 16-тиричный из таблицы от разарбов. программатора, т.е. например первое слово (8-мь бит)по адресу 300000_21, у разрабов в этом адресе двоичный код :00100001 открываем калькулятор windows включаем режим программист ну и набираем этот код как bin, а потом переключаем в hex и получим тоже самое число 21 в 16-тиричн. сист. счисл., например по адресу 300006_A1, проверяем, от разарбов код 10100001 калькулятор выдал число A1.

Конфиг.Janus.png

bin.png

hex.png

Ссылка на комментарий
Поделиться на другие сайты

Да я это все нашел там даже в самой прошивке есть если знать куда смотреть. Но я наверное сделал глупость повторно прошил пик с правильными битами и теперь он не работает. Винда не видит светодиод на плате не моргает. Пытаюсь стереть говорит стер а на самом деле не стирает.

Пробовал сперва без галки на прошивки битов но он не прошивается вернее при верификации сразу ошибка. Пробовал читать там непонятки. ерунда в начале одни нули. Теперь не знаю что с ней делать. Был бы магазин пошел бы купил а так из китая долго а нужно вчера.

Ссылка на комментарий
Поделиться на другие сайты

Хм, симптоматика похожа на неправильно запрограммированный "жизненно важный" Fuse_bit, вот для контроллеров AVR я впервую очередь собрал Fuse_Bit_Doctor, он просто незаменимая палочка выручалочка, тем более для меня, неопытного программюги, а вот с PIC контроллерами я вообще впервые встретился как раз собирая Janus-а, вам нужен совет от знающего человека..

Ссылка на комментарий
Поделиться на другие сайты

Играя с MCLR, вы скорее всего перевели его в режим порта. Вас спасет программатор, который может подать Vpp до Vdd, чтобы МК не стартанул, а перешёл в режим программирования. Иначе говоря, программатор, имеющий ключи на выводах питания. Например, родной PICKit3. Либо какая-то модификация имеющегося у вас.

Изменено пользователем Zhuk72
Ссылка на комментарий
Поделиться на другие сайты

  • 4 месяца спустя...

Для ленивых.

Таблица конфигурации правильная. Подключаем МК к программатору, определяем МК, загружаем прошивку, программируем без галки fuse, верифицируем, заполняем вкладку fuse в оболочке picpgm (00100001 в bin это 21 в hex, 0010100 - 28 и т.д.). После заполнения всех fuse прошиваем только их. После прошивки fuse верификация проходить не будет. Прошивал лично таким образом, затем уже обновлял прошивку из самой оболочки ChipStar через USB. USB кабель нужен качественный! 

Ссылка на комментарий
Поделиться на другие сайты

  • 7 месяцев спустя...

Подскажите пожалуйста, нужно прошить pic18f25k80. В проге PICPgm 1.9.3.1 чип не определяется, как правильно настроить. Схемка программатора которым пользуюсь во вложении.

dh1.jpg.e3e9aa080900bdb6fa8c4e43353c1c4b.jpgdh2.jpg.f6da08bb419ed2850ae91cbf6c2c0568.jpgdh3.jpg.f63c11964dfc22bef4815cb078efcb23.jpgdh4.jpg.3bb8b63b3bf11fd8c03f90799fd3c18d.jpgShema.gif.b2a6707a296a5bb94180202be25ae13c.gif

Ссылка на комментарий
Поделиться на другие сайты

Да сом порт в материнке стандартный, программатор подключен через удлинитель на сом порт. Самим программатором уже не раз шил разные контроллеры, а с этим пиком никак не получается.

Ссылка на комментарий
Поделиться на другие сайты

1. максимальное напряжение программирования для pic18f25k80 Vpp=9v
в вашем прогере 13.2в , могли тупо спалить чип.
2.  шина данных PGD является двунаправленной шиной с подтяжкой на Vdd , выход буффера передатчика данных должен быть по схеме ОК или иметь развязку с шиной через диод. ХЕР40106 имеет полумостовой выход.
3.Как подключен pic18f25k80 к прогеру? где полная схема подключения , с наименованиями пинов и указанием типа корпуса? ваши картинки настройки прогера пока вообще ни о чем.
4. что помешало в программе указать нужную модель чипа в ручную?

Ссылка на комментарий
Поделиться на другие сайты

1. Напряжение VPP 9 вольт, понизил с помощью 3 последовательно соединенных диодов.

2. Этим программатором не получится прошить?

3. Подключал согласно даташиту кроме 6 вывода. Чип в корпусе SSOP28

4. Указывал, не шьет, не проходит верификацию.

pic18f25k80.jpg

Ссылка на комментарий
Поделиться на другие сайты

1.  лучше 8..8,5

2. ну так диод поставь и подтяжку сделай, набирай в гугле EXTRAPIC и смотри как сделано. (если конечно не спалил чип)

3. на вывод 6 для версии  F вешается конденсатор 10мкф тантал иначе ничего не будет

4. так он может и не проходить если биты зашиты устанавливаются и пока не выполнен пункт.2 и 3, или прога не передает код инициализации режима программирования 4D434850h, надо осциллографом или логером смотреть
 

Ссылка на комментарий
Поделиться на другие сайты

  • 1 месяц спустя...
  • 9 месяцев спустя...

Приветствую всех! Тема жива еще?? Если да то подскажите пожалуйста в чем может быть проблема, прошил контроллер по вышеуказанной инструкции, но при подключении  к пк выскакивает USB устройство неопознано проверил уже все что только можно и даже заказал уже прошитый контроллер, сегодня пришел. поставил на плату и таже самая ошибка. 

- - - - - - - -- - - - - - -- - - -- - - --  - -- -- - - -- -  - - - -- 

Все!!!! разобрался! каким то образом затек припой между контактом D- и корпусом самого usb разъема, все на миллион раз проверил, а вот разъем не догадался... 

Изменено пользователем GeParDos
Ссылка на комментарий
Поделиться на другие сайты

Присоединяйтесь к обсуждению

Вы можете написать сейчас и зарегистрироваться позже. Если у вас есть аккаунт, авторизуйтесь, чтобы опубликовать от имени своего аккаунта.
Примечание: Ваш пост будет проверен модератором, прежде чем станет видимым.

Гость
Unfortunately, your content contains terms that we do not allow. Please edit your content to remove the highlighted words below.
Ответить в этой теме...

×   Вставлено с форматированием.   Восстановить форматирование

  Разрешено использовать не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отображать как обычную 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ставлять изображения напрямую. Загружайте или вставляйте изображения по ссылке.

Загрузка...
  • Последние посетители   0 пользователей онлайн

    • Ни одного зарегистрированного пользователя не просматривает данную страницу
  • Сообщения

    • Присоединяюсь   Я имел в виду габариты корпуса. Переносной, навроде детешки, или настольный, габаритами, как например, VC8145. Это определит какие будут использоваться решения, ведь впихнуть в размер детешки кучу реле будет проблематично, и жить такое решение даже от литиевого АКБ будет относительно недолго. В современных тестерах зачастую используется только один чип типа "всё-в-одном" который выполняет все функции измерителя. Перед ним в режиме измерения напряжения втыкается резистор 10МОм, и всё. Внутри чипа осуществляется коммутация. Конкретного механизма я не знаю, могу лишь предположить, что вместе с этим входным резистором и подключением одного из резисторов в наборе сопротивлений (который иногда бывает прямо внутри чипа), формируется делитель с нужным коэффициентом. Делать такое самому с нуля - дело не то чтобы приятное/нужное. Не могу себе представить, где может потребоваться сейчас - в эпоху детешек - самодельный портативный вольтамперметр, который по свойствам будет как среднестатистическая китайская детешка... Это 1024 отсчёта,  плюс-минус поправка на погрешности/нелинейности... Возникает вопрос, в таком случае, зачем внешний АЦП, когда у контроллера он уже есть, 12ти битный. Куда денутся все пины МК?... Ну и даже если всё будет совсем плохо, всегда есть возможность накинуть сдвиговые регистры, для условных переключателей пределов это будет нормальным решением. Я скорее привёл это как пример, что делать индивидуальный шунт  на каждый предел не нужно. В теории такое возможно, но учтите, что мощность на шунте при 5А и 50мА будет разная, и придется повозиться с усилением сигнала минимум в 100 раз (это можно доверить микросхеме типа INA181A3). Проблема, как мне кажется, проявится при калибровке пределов, надо будет продумать коммутацию. В мозгу была идея зацепить цепочку из звеньев "резистор-подстроечник", каждое из которых задаст нужный коэфф усиления схемы после шунта, и за счёт подстроечника позволит подогнать его в некоторых пределах, скажем, +/-0,5%. А схема коммутации будет переключать точку включения оос усилителя в этой цепи, т.о. при калибровке надо будет идти от бОльшего токового предела к меньшему, подкручивая каждый раз добавляющийся в схему подстроечник. Другой вопрос что в цифровой схеме ручная подстройка это как-то "по-древнему", но это одно из простых решений   Я бы сделал 5А+ отдельным гнездом, как обычно в приборах делают высокотоковые отдельные гнезда на 10А/20А.   Да, ОУ с переключением усиления между х1 и х10. Что-то навроде такого:
    • Да. Мостик диодный хорошенько пощупать, а отсутствие КЗ в ШИМке не факт исправности, просто ключ выгорел быстрее всего.
    • У ТСа вопрос стоит между двумя конкретными ЦП, а не вообще, что лучше всего. Вопрос стоял очень конкретно, и ответ должен быть без распыления - C2D лучше.
    • Выпаял супрессор поз. CD01, действительно перестал звониться (при установке звонится), то есть он оказался исправен, благодарю! Если я верно понял, то речь о позициях C104, R103, D102, то они отсутствуют на моей плате (указал выше), я их просто отметил для того, чтобы лучше ориентироваться. С105 (электролитический бочонок, он не выходит на бесконечное сопротивление, но набирает его до значения 860 в режиме прозвонки) заменить не проблема, с С106 (кремниевый SMD) придётся что-то выдумать. Вы могли бы уточнить, о каких электролитических конденсаторах идёт речь — просто о всех «бочкообразных»? Согласно этому ролику (для аналогичного TNY264), проверить на КЗ достаточно только крайние пары ног (напротив друг друга), с ними всё хорошо — КЗ отсутствует. Буду признателен, если что-то упустил.
    • За бесплатно, думаю, никто за эту работу не возьмется.
×
×
  • Создать...